Job description

Description

Tarantino Properties is looking to add a Software and Operations Support Specialist to join our corporate office in Houston, Texas.

The Software and Operations Support Specialist is responsible for the ongoing support of the company’s property management software systems. This role bridges the gap between the operations, accounting, and IT teams to ensure software platforms support business objectives, enhance operational efficiency, and comply with regulatory standards.

Tarantino Properties is a full-service real estate company specializing in income producing real estate. Founded in 1980, our company provides a full complement of property management, brokerage, leasing and renovation services for commercial, residential and senior living properties throughout the United States.

At Tarantino Properties, we have the people, the tools, the experience, and the expertise to accommodate a wide variety of real estate investment and management requirements. We specialize in commercial office leasing, apartment management, senior living management, retail space, flex, industrial and warehouse properties. We work with our clients to develop the business plans and make the key decisions that will help them ultimately reach their goals, because we only succeed when our clients do.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Serve as the subject matter expert for the company’s property management software (RealPage products, Entrata, and Bluemoon).
  • Work closely with property managers, accountants, and leadership to ensure accurate setup of rent structures, fees, ledgers, and reporting tools.
  • Provide ongoing support for current users.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ve software issues in a timely and effective manner.
  • Collaborate with vendors to manage integration with other platforms (e.g., utility billing, leasing, CRM, maintenance, Marketing Syndication etc.).
  • Assist in the setup of new users in the system, ensuring appropriate access rights, and role-based permissions.
  • Maintain user permissions, data integrity, and system documentation.
  • Set up properties with the appropriate utility billing vendor to ensure timely payment of property utilities and accurate resident billing.
  • Update FCO and Flex monthly with information regarding new property takeovers and dispositions to ensure accuracy.
Requirements
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ience working with property management software.
  • Bachelor’s Degree preferred but not required.
  • NAA OR HAA Certifications are a plus.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ively collaborate with coworkers, vendors, and on-site property management teams.
  • Demonstrated 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ks, projects, and de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• Ability to work effectively both independently and as a part of a team.
  • Proactive and solutions-oriented mindset, with strong probl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
  • Highly detail-oriented, dependable, and committed to maintaining accuracy in all areas of work.
